Hi,
Can anyone help me with a problem am having with my 2005 A4 140. I put it into the garage to have the glow plugs replaced and since getting it back have noticed that when it is cold it starts first turn of the key but once it is up to running temp it takes 4 turns of the engine before it will start. Any glues as to what this might be the garage has no idea.
 
hi there, i have a mate who had the same problem as you on a vw touran i think it is but it was a VAG car any way, eventually his starter motor completely packed in and when he replaced it the problem was no more. I have never heard of starters doing this sort of thing but the way i see it the starters are probably very similar in a lot of models across the VAG range and it is probably worth a shot if it is annoying you too much.
